What is Dynamic Data Masking?
Dynamic Data Masking restricts access to sensitive data by hiding or obfuscating it during runtime. Authorized users can view full data, while non-authorized users see masked or partial information. This provides an effective layer of security and ensures that critical information isn’t inadvertently exposed.
This mechanism differs from static masking, as DDM occurs in real time without changing the actual data in storage. By leveraging DDM, businesses can ensure they meet governance standards while maintaining functionality.
Why Legal Compliance Requires DDM
Governments and regulatory bodies implement stringent data protection laws to govern how sensitive data is accessed and stored. Violating legal mandates can result in hefty fines, lawsuits, and reputational damage. Here’s why DDM is a key tool in meeting these obligations:
Laws like GDPR, HIPAA, and CCPA demand strict safeguarding of PII, including names, addresses, financial details, and more. Dynamic Data Masking ensures this data isn’t fully exposed to unauthorized users in real time.
For example, GDPR mandates organizations to only share data that fulfills the principle of “data minimization.” DDM enables you to demonstrate this by only showing the data required for specific operations.
2. Role-Based Access Controls
Many legal frameworks require user access to follow need-to-know principles. DDM, integrated with role-based access controls, ensures that data exposure is limited to individuals who genuinely need it. This is especially vital for organizations with multiple teams or third-party integrations.
3. Reduced Risk During Data Audits
Organizations must often undergo audits to verify compliance. Having an active DDM implementation ensures that auditors see clear evidence of data minimization and effective safeguarding practices. It also simplifies capturing logs for audit trails showing who accessed what level of data.
Implementing DDM for Compliance
A poorly planned DDM infrastructure can turn into a bottleneck. To ensure both technical efficiency and compliance, follow these key steps:
Step 1: Identify Sensitive Data
Begin by cataloging the sensitive fields subject to data privacy laws. Common data types include financial information, social security numbers, and health data. Identify these fields in your database schema to know what to protect.
Step 2: Map Applicable Regulations
Match sensitive data types to compliance regulations relevant to your region and industry. Whether GDPR in the EU or HIPAA for healthcare data in the U.S., knowing the exact requirements helps ensure your implementation is audit-proof.
Step 3: Apply Custom Masking Policies
Dynamic Data Masking allows flexibility, meaning not all fields require the same masking level. Structure policies based on user roles, regions, and compliance requirements. Keep policies granular but manageable.
Step 4: Integrate with Existing Systems
You don’t need to overhaul your database to implement DDM. Most popular relational database systems, such as SQL Server or PostgreSQL, include native DDM functionalities. Ensure they integrate seamlessly into your existing workflows to maintain performance.
Step 5: Monitor and Adjust Continuously
Compliance is not static. Laws evolve, and so do threats to data security. Regularly review and refine DDM configurations to keep pace with both regulatory requirements and real-world scenarios.
